I have a 2008 G35 sedan and cannot figure out how to reset the trip miles on the odometer?
I cannot find the owner manual as well and am having the hardest time figuring this out. Anyone able to help? =)
Source: Yahoo! Answers, 4 answers

OK, first, look to the bottom right side of the car dash, behind the steering wheel. There should be a small, rectangular button. That says "reset" or "A/B reset" (I forget which) Anyway, hold this button for about 6 seconds. it will reset both the "A" and...

Why should I also consider these? X

When it comes to premium sedans, there is no shortage of candidates worthy of your attention.

The best-selling car in this bunch is the well-respected BMW 3 Series.

There's no doubt that the Bimmer is an excellent choice, but the 2008 Infiniti G35 is an equally good selection.

The Audi A4 is due for a remake in 2009, so the current model is getting a little old.

However, if you're looking for a front-wheel-drive sedan, the Audi qualifies (it also offers AWD).

The Acura TL is another solid front-wheel-drive option, but it is not as sporting in character as the G35.

Ditto for the Lexus IS, even though it is rear-wheel driven (with an all-wheel-drive option).

A less expensive alternative to the G35 is the Subaru Legacy.
